Unveiling the Magic Behind These Vegan Cranberry Orange Muffins
These muffins stand out not just for their exceptional taste but also for their impressive texture and entirely vegan composition. Imagine a muffin with a light, fluffy crumb that’s incredibly soft and moist – that’s precisely what you get here, all without a single egg or even a flax egg! So, what’s the secret to achieving such a delightful texture in a plant-based recipe?
The unsung hero in this recipe is a ripe banana. Mashed banana works wonders as a natural egg replacer in vegan baking, providing essential moisture and binding properties that replicate the role of eggs. It contributes to the muffins’ soft and fluffy structure without imparting an overpowering banana flavor. In fact, you’ll find that the robust flavors of cranberry, orange, and warm spices beautifully mask any subtle banana notes, leaving you with a perfectly balanced and incredibly tender muffin. Tips for Baking Perfect Vegan Muffins
Achieving perfectly fluffy and moist vegan muffins is surprisingly simple with a few key techniques. First, avoid overmixing the batter. Once the wet and dry ingredients are combined, stir just until everything is moistened. Overmixing can develop the gluten in the flour too much, leading to tough muffins. Second, ensure your banana is ripe, with plenty of brown spots, as this ensures maximum sweetness and moisture. Third, don’t be afraid to fill your muffin cups about three-quarters full to get those lovely domed tops. Finally, keep an eye on your baking time; ovens can vary, and baking until just golden brown and a toothpick inserted into the center comes out clean will prevent dryness. These muffins are best enjoyed warm, but they also store beautifully in an airtight container at room temperature for up to three days, or in the freezer for longer enjoyment.

Cranberry Orange Muffins (Vegan)
Pin Recipe
10 minutes
20 minutes
30 minutes
11
muffins
Ingredients
- 1½ cup all-purpose flour
- ¼ cup light brown sugar
- ½ cup white sugar
- ¼ teaspoon salt
- 2 teaspoons baking powder
- 1 teaspoon cinnamon
- ¼ teaspoon nutmeg
- ⅓ cup Blue Diamond Almondmilk Cashewmilk Blend
- ⅓ cup coconut oil, melted (or vegetable oil)
- 1 large banana, mashed (about ½ cup)
- 1 teaspoon orange zest, about the zest of 1 orange
- 1 cup fresh cranberries
For the crumb topping
- ⅓ cup all-purpose flour
- ⅓ cup light brown sugar
- ⅛ teaspoon kosher salt
- ⅛ teaspoon cinnamon
- ¼ cup coconut oil, melted
Instructions
-
Preheat oven to 400°F (200°C). Grease muffin cups or line with paper muffin liners.
-
In a large bowl, whisk together the flour, light brown sugar, white sugar, salt, baking powder, cinnamon, and nutmeg. Add the Almondmilk Cashewmilk Blend, melted coconut oil, mashed banana, and orange zest. Stir gently until just moistened. Fold in the fresh cranberries. Do not overmix. Fill prepared muffin cups about ¾ full.
-
To prepare the streusel, combine all the crumble ingredients (flour, light brown sugar, kosher salt, cinnamon, and melted coconut oil) in a separate bowl. Use your fingertips to work the coconut oil into the dry ingredients until coarse crumbles form. Generously divide the streusel mixture evenly among the filled muffin cups.
-
Bake for 18-22 minutes in the preheated oven, or until the tops are golden brown and a toothpick inserted into the center of a muffin comes out clean. Let cool slightly before serving.
